i have no idea about him so looked him up in the phantom drafts. here is the overview by knightmare. i dont know knightmares credentials but it makes interesting reading especially for us novices:

24. William Hayward (SA)
Best position:
General forward
Height, weight: 186cm, 76kg
Recruited from: North Adelaide
Plays like: James Sicily
Projected draft range: second round onwards
Rated last month: Unrated
Rationale behind ranking/change of ranking: Has earned his way onto draft board on the back of an outstanding SANFL Under-18 finals series up forward.
Strengths:
- Marking at highest point
- Marking on the lead
- Timing of leads
- One-on-one marking
- Aerial marking
- Vertical leap
- Attacks ball in the air
- Gets front position in marking contests
- Reads drop of ball
- Scoreboard impact
- Genuine No. 1 option in forward 50m
- Football smarts
-Clean at ground level
Weaknesses:
- Unproven outside forward 50m
- Not a big ball winner
- Possible but unclear midfield potential
